Output fe296d8b7e76ebe148b6b0efff61986de5e0cfd10a48bf22531744c4f9885a8b:1

value
19842900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b60b845f5bb1c80a63e49d3da721a05f053eb2 OP_EQUAL
address
3MSsxgnEuphqjPQiEAnjUwXhJXmM3QzJn2
transaction
fe296d8b7e76ebe148b6b0efff61986de5e0cfd10a48bf22531744c4f9885a8b
confirmations
349869
spent
true